Abstract

In this paper, the relative relevance of input and output variables in achieving the control performance is analysed. In order to compare different control structures, the performances of the closed loop controlled system are expressed by the poles' position. Attached to each input (output), the control effort (control contribution) is defined as the inverse of the maximum admissible delay in its path without provoking instability. This delay, that can be roughly estimated by the shift of the open-to-closed loop poles under the variable connection, is defined as the variable relevance in the control structure. As digital control implies open-loop control in the intersampling time interval, there is always a time delay in the updating of the control. Small time delays in the most relevant variables may result in unstable behaviour.
